- [ ] Step 7: Archive cold storage buckets (Glacierline tier). Confirm both ceremony witnesses are present, verify bucket manifests match the Oxbow ledger, then seal the archive key shares. Plugin authors may observe but not handle shares. Once sealed, the archive index itself is encrypted and can only be reopened with the passphrase below.

vault phrase of badup-hahig = tamael-aldael-kelmir-istael-fenok-istwyn-tamius-jorath-oliion

## Transport: Survey Instrument Crate

The crate of survey instruments for the Darrow Flats project ships from the Lindvale warehouse each Monday. Shift leads must verify the foam inserts are seated, padlock the lid, and record the crate weight on the bay sheet before release. At hand-over, the courier is to carry out the step below.

handover note for bafof-bawif: the praok sorox courier leaves the eliox ledger at gate 3435 under passcode 620472

Finance review summary for department heads: the Quarrington systems migration remains roughly two quarters behind plan. Spend to date is within the revised envelope, but contractor costs from Bellith Consulting are trending high. We have deferred the reporting-module phase and reallocated that budget to stabilisation work. A revised completion forecast will circulate after month-end close. One confidential note on dependent plans follows below.

board note of fahif-yahog: Gross margin on Wenath came in at 10 percent against a plan of 5 percent. Only 3 of the 100 pilot accounts renewed Wenath, so a churn review is set for July 15.